Writer : Adam SmithAn Inquiry into the Nature and Causes of the Wealth of Nations by Adam Smith is a groundbreaking work that explores the principles of economics and capitalism. Published in 1776, this influential book laid the foundation for modern economic theory and is considered one of the most important books ever written on the subject. Adam Smith discusses the division of labor, the invisible hand of the market, and the role of government in regulating commerce. He argues that a free market economy, driven by self-interest and competition, can lead to wealth and prosperity for a nation as a whole. Smith's ideas on free trade and the benefits of a market economy have had a lasting impact on economic thought and policy. This seminal work is essential reading for anyone interested in understanding the fundamental principles of economics and the forces that shape our modern economy."
